Hi Victor,

Thanks for your patch.

It look like the build is failing on various platforms:

ERROR: systemtap-5.4-r0 do_compile: Execution of '/srv/pokybuild/yocto-worker/qemux86/build/build/tmp/work/core2-32-poky-linux/systemtap/5.4/temp/run.do_compile.1003148' failed with exit code 1
...
| In file included from ../sources/systemtap-5.4/staptree.h:27,
|                  from ../sources/systemtap-5.4/elaborate.h:12,
|                  from ../sources/systemtap-5.4/elaborate.cxx:11:
| ../sources/systemtap-5.4/elaborate.cxx: In member function 'virtual void const_folder::visit_defined_op(defined_op*)':
| ../sources/systemtap-5.4/elaborate.cxx:5119:33: error: format '%ld' expects argument of type 'long int', but argument 2 has type 'int64_t' {aka 'long long int'} [-Werror=format=]
|  5119 |       session.print_warning (_F("Collapsing unresolved @define to %ld [stapprobes]", value), e->tok);
|       |                                 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
| ../sources/systemtap-5.4/staputil.h:54:27: note: in definition of macro '_'
|    54 | #define _(string) gettext(string)
